Prince Maurits and Princess Marilène were present at the handing out of the Prix de Rome 2007 Tuesday afternoon in the Rolzaal in The Hague. The Prix de Rome is an award for young artists and architects and was handed out by the Minister of Education, mr. Plasterk (left on the photo).

Actress Kim van Kooten wrote a Dutch equivalant to the romantic comedy ´Love Actually´, called ´Alles is liefde´ (All is love). In the movie one of the characters is a Prince called Valentijn. According to Kim van Kooten the character is based on Prince Maurits.
